Great day at the Bluffton Scorcher!

We had 8 runners come out today for the optional Bluffton Scorcher 5K held in Hampton Hall. Sam Gilman came in 2nd overall for the boys ages 13-15 with an impressive time and PR of 17:52. Callie Haertel came in 5th for the girls ages 13-15 with a time of 22:35. Full official results will be available soon. Great job Eagles!

Welcome to XC 2014


Hello friends,

I would like to invite you all to be a part of the HHCA Cross Country team in our 2nd year as a new sport at Hilton Head Christian Academy.  If you are new to cross country, it is a sport where you will mentally and physically challenged to run long distances over varied course terrain.  We have 10 meets scheduled for this fall, including some incredible local meets and 5Ks and trips to Columbia and Charleston.  All meets include a 5K race for boys and girls with the top 5 runners from each team counting for a combined score.  We will practice on Mondays, Tuesdays and Thursdays typically from 4-5:30pm @ HHCA and then an additional practice on Saturday mornings at various locations.  Meets are typically on either Saturdays or Wednesdays.  

The benefit of doing cross country is not only will it get you in incredible shape for any other sports, but it will challenge you in new ways to persevere and support your teammates.  I think that there are many spiritual and life applications to running cross country and we get to enjoy some of the most incredible scenery on Hilton Head as we run across different parts of the island.
